The service is always wonderful but some of the other things need a little work. The robes are dingy and look as though they haven't been washed. They aren't crisp and clean like they should be.They really need to be replaced. Also, the toilet paper is cheap and thin. Yuck. You need to put some money back in to these things at the spa. I know that you encourage your employees to sell products as part of their service but I find it very annoying. If I ask for product advice that is one thing but leave the sales stuff out of the spa. It is really annoying and takes away from the relaxing experience. I won't go certain people on your staff, because of the sales pitch. Their abilities are wonderful but what a way to ruin a very relaxing massage to have to deal with someone trying to sell me something. It's very annoying.
